PROBE MANAGEMENT MESSAGES FOR VEHICLE-SOURCED INFRASTRUCTURE QUALITY METRICS

    Abstract: In some examples, a sign maintenance system includes a traffic management control system; a plurality of road side equipment; and an infrastructure management service provider; wherein a sign maintenance application determines information needed for sign maintenance planning and transmits a probe management request to the traffic management control system requesting the information; wherein the traffic management control system transmits a probe management message to road side equipment in response to the probe management request, receives one or more messages received from connected vehicles, the messages reflecting sensor information captured by sensors of the connected vehicles, and transmits, to the infrastructure management service provider, the information received from the vehicle messages, and wherein the sign maintenance application in the infrastructure maintenance service provider schedules sign maintenance based on the information received from the connected vehicles.

    SIGNAL BLOCKING DETECTION IN OFFENDER MONITORING SYSTEMS

    Abstract: An electronic monitoring device for monitoring an individual and detecting signal blocking. The electronic monitoring device may be equipped with GPS and/or RF communication technology that may be interrupted intentionally or unintentionally. The device compares sampled incident energy with a reference level to identify an occurrence of blocking the transmitter signal. The device may also base determination of a signal blocking occurrence on input from a status detection module. Status information is also leveraged to intelligently calibrate the device to more robustly determine a tampering event.

    VEHICLE-SOURCED INFRASTRUCTURE QUALITY METRICS

    Abstract: In some examples, a computing device includes one or more computer processors, a communication device, and a memory comprising instructions that cause the one or more computer processors to: receive, using the communication device and from a set of vehicles, different sets of infrastructure data for a particular infrastructure article that is proximate to each respective vehicle of the set of vehicles, wherein each respective vehicle in the set of vehicles comprises at least one infrastructure sensor that generates infrastructure data descriptive of infrastructure articles that are proximate to the respective vehicle; determine, based at least in part on the different sets of infrastructure data for the particular infrastructure article from each respective vehicle of the set of vehicles, a quality metric for the infrastructure article; and perform at least one operation based at least in part on the quality metric for the infrastructure article.
